Siding Installation in Custer: Built for Whatcom County's Coastal Climate

Custer sits close enough to the water that homes here take a different kind of weather beating than houses even a few miles inland. Salt-laden air off the Strait of Georgia and Birch Bay, wind-driven rain that finds every gap in a wall system, and a moss season that can run most of the year all put real stress on exterior siding. A siding installation done for a Custer home needs to account for all three, not just look good on install day.

What Custer Homes Face Along the Salish Sea

Salt Air

Airborne salt from Birch Bay and the surrounding waterways accelerates corrosion on fasteners, trim metal, and any siding material that relies on paint film integrity to stay protected. Over years, salt exposure finds weak points — exposed end grain, chipped caulk lines, thin factory coatings — faster than it would on a home set back from the water.

Driving Rain

Storms coming off the water don't just fall straight down; wind pushes rain sideways into wall assemblies. Siding and flashing details that work fine in a dry climate can fail here because water gets pushed up and under laps instead of running down and off. The water-resistive barrier and flashing behind the siding matter as much as the siding itself.

Moss Season

Whatcom County's long wet stretch, shaded lots, and tree cover mean moss and algae growth is a near-constant issue on north-facing and shaded wall sections. Siding materials that hold moisture — or that need frequent recoating to resist organic growth — become a maintenance chore that never really ends.

Why James Hardie Fiber Cement Is the Right Fit for This Climate

Fiber cement doesn't rot, doesn't provide the same food source for moss and algae that wood-based products do, and doesn't swell or delaminate when it takes on moisture the way some engineered wood sidings can. James Hardie's ColorPlus factory finish is baked on under controlled conditions, which holds up better against salt air and UV than field-applied paint. The HZ5 product line, specifically, is engineered for climates with more moisture exposure — which describes Custer well.

What a Correct Siding Installation Actually Involves

Water Management First

Before a single piece of siding goes up, the water-resistive barrier, window and door flashing, and any penetrations (vents, hose bibs, light fixtures) need to be sequenced correctly — each layer lapping over the one below so water sheds outward, never inward. This is the part of the job that's invisible once siding is installed, and it's also the part most likely to cause problems years later if it's rushed.

Fastening to Spec

James Hardie publishes specific fastening patterns, nail types, and clearances for each product line and climate zone. Corrosion-resistant fasteners matter more here than in a dry inland climate — salt air will find any fastener that isn't rated for it. Installing to the manufacturer's published spec isn't optional if you want the warranty to actually apply.

Clearances and Gaps

Siding needs proper clearance from grade, roof lines, decks, and other transitions so water and debris don't sit against the bottom edge. In a high-moisture area like Custer, a siding installer who ignores clearance specs to save time is setting up a callback in a few years — usually after the damage is already done behind the wall.

Joint and Seam Treatment

Butt joints, corners, and trim transitions need to be treated with the right sealants and flashing details — not just caulked and painted over. Done correctly, these details are what keep driving rain from working its way behind the cladding during a wind-driven storm.

Our Installation Process

1. On-Site Assessment

We walk the home, check the current siding and sheathing condition, note problem areas (shaded walls prone to moss, exposure to prevailing wind and rain, any existing water damage), and talk through what the job actually needs — not a generic package.

2. Tear-Off and Substrate Check

Old siding comes off and we inspect the sheathing underneath. Any rot or moisture damage gets addressed before new water-resistive barrier and siding go on — covering up a compromised substrate just hides a problem instead of fixing it.

3. Water-Resistive Barrier and Flashing

New barrier, flashing at windows, doors, and penetrations, all sequenced to shed water outward. This is the step that determines how the wall performs during the next big coastal storm.

4. Hardie Installation to Manufacturer Spec

Panels or lap siding installed with correct fastener type, spacing, and clearances, following James Hardie's published instructions for the specific product and region.

5. Trim, Caulking, and Final Detail

Corners, trim boards, and joints finished and sealed correctly, with attention to the areas most exposed to wind-driven rain.

6. Walkthrough

We go over the finished job with the homeowner, including basic care notes for a coastal Whatcom County property — what to check seasonally and what maintenance (if any) the ColorPlus finish actually requires.

Comparing Siding Options for a Custer Home

MaterialMoisture/Salt Air BehaviorMoss/Algae ResistanceMaintenance Over Time
James Hardie Fiber Cement (HZ5)Non-combustible, engineered for high-moisture climatesDoesn't feed organic growth like wood-based productsFactory ColorPlus finish, low upkeep
VinylCan warp/distort with temperature swings; seams can trap moistureModerate; surface staining common in shaded, damp areasLow cost, but limited lifespan and color fade over time
CedarNatural material, but absorbs moisture and can rot without diligent upkeepProne to moss/algae without regular treatmentOngoing staining/sealing required, especially near salt air
Engineered Wood (e.g. LP SmartSide)Treated to resist moisture, but edge/end-grain exposure is a known sensitivityBetter than untreated wood, still organic materialRequires diligent caulking and inspection at seams

Cost Factors on a Real Job

FactorWhy It Matters Here
Home size and wall complexityMore corners, trim, and transitions mean more labor and detail work
Substrate conditionRot or water damage found during tear-off adds repair scope before siding goes on
Product line (HZ5 vs. standard) and profileCoastal exposure often calls for the higher-moisture-rated line
Trim and accessory scopeCorner boards, fascia, and soffit work are often bundled with a siding job
Access and site conditionsSlopes, landscaping, and setbacks common in the Birch Bay/Custer area can affect labor time

Signs Your Custer Home Needs New Siding

  • Persistent moss or algae staining that returns soon after cleaning, especially on shaded walls
  • Soft spots, bubbling, or visible warping in the current siding
  • Paint or finish that's chalking, peeling, or fading faster than expected
  • Visible gaps at seams, corners, or trim where wind-driven rain could get behind the wall
  • Rising energy bills that may point to a compromised weather barrier
  • Siding that's original to an older home and has never been fully inspected behind the surface

How long does a full siding installation typically take?

Most single-family homes take one to two weeks from tear-off to final trim, depending on size, substrate condition, and weather. Coastal weather windows can affect scheduling, so we build some flexibility into the timeline. Rushed installs are how water management details get skipped, so we don't compress the schedule to hit an arbitrary date.

What should I check before hiring a siding contractor in Whatcom County?

Confirm they carry proper licensing and insurance for exterior work in Washington, and ask specifically how they handle flashing and water-resistive barrier installation — not just the visible siding. Ask for references from other jobs in the area, since a crew unfamiliar with coastal exposure may not account for it. Also ask whether they follow the manufacturer's published fastening and clearance specs, since skipping those can void a product warranty.

What's the difference between standard Hardie siding and the HZ5 product line?

James Hardie engineers certain product lines, including HZ5, specifically for regions with higher moisture and humidity exposure, like the Pacific Northwest coast. The difference shows up in how the product is formulated to handle sustained damp conditions over years, not in the surface appearance. For a property as close to the water as Custer, that climate-specific engineering is worth the consideration.

Does Custer's proximity to Birch Bay affect how siding should be installed?

Yes — homes closer to the water take more direct salt air exposure and wind-driven rain than homes further inland in Whatcom County, which puts more demand on fastener corrosion resistance, flashing details, and finish durability. It doesn't change the core installation method, but it does affect which product line and detailing choices we recommend.
